What Is an Attorney Rating Website?
Anlawyer review platformis a platform that aggregates reviews, ratings, and other relevant information about attorneys in various practice areas. These websites allow potential clients to find lawyers who specialize in specific fields, such as family law, criminal defense, or personal injury, based on ratings from previous clients and professional evaluations. Popular platforms like Avvo, Martindale-Hubbell, and Lawyers. com help individuals make informed decisions when hiring a lawyer.

What to Look for in an Attorney Rating Website
Not alllawyer review platform sare created equal. When evaluating these platforms, consider the following:
- Authenticity of Reviews:Ensure that the reviews are verified and come from real clients. Some websites offer verified client feedback, which helps maintain credibility.
- Attorney’s Ratings:Check for ratings from both clients and peers. Websites like Martindale-Hubbell offer “AV Preeminent” ratings, the highest distinction for professional excellence.
- Attorney Retainer:Look for information about the attorney’s retainer fees. Websites may also offer tools to inquire about fees directly from lawyers to give you an idea of potential costs.
Understanding Attorneys Ratings
When navigating anlawyer review platform, understanding the ratings system is crucial. Most websites use a numerical or star rating system to assess attorney quality, based on client satisfaction, legal expertise, and professional conduct. A higher rating generally indicates a more reputable lawyer, but consider the volume of reviews to ensure reliability. Additionally, professional peer reviews can offer valuable insights into an attorney’s standing in the legal community. For example, an attorney with a highattorneys ratingsscore typically has proven skills and a reputation for ethical practice.
How Attorney Retainers Work
Theattorney retaineragreement is another critical factor to consider. This is the fee that a client pays upfront for legal services, often in advance of any actual legal work being performed. Many law firms require retainers for ongoing legal services, particularly in cases involving complex or long-term litigation. Be sure to discuss retainer fees clearly with any attorney you’re considering through the website.

The Role of Attorney Rating Websites
lawyer review platform s serve as tools that aggregate reviews and evaluations from various sources, offering a comprehensive view of an attorney’s performance. These platforms typically feature detailed profiles that include an attorney’s areas of expertise, years of practice, disciplinary history, and client reviews. For individuals seeking legal help, these websites are an invaluable resource that can guide their choice of representation.

How Attorney Retainers Work and Their Influence on Ratings
When hiring an attorney, clients typically sign an attorney retainer agreement. This agreement outlines the fees, responsibilities, and terms of engagement. The quality of these agreements can be an indicator of an attorney’s professionalism and attention to detail. A transparent retainer agreement, along with fair and clear pricing, can improve an attorney’s rating. It also sets expectations for both the attorney and the client, reducing the likelihood of misunderstandings and dissatisfaction.
